Canada Protective Relay Market Overview

Market Valuation :

Canada's protective relay market is valued at $106.0 million in 2024, with projected growth to $145.0 million by 2029, representing a 5.4% CAGR driven by infrastructure modernization initiatives across provinces.

Grid Modernization Investment :

Canadian utilities are prioritizing smart grid technologies and digital transformation to enhance grid reliability and efficiency, creating significant demand for advanced protective relay solutions across transmission and distribution networks.

Renewable Energy Integration :

Canada's transition toward renewable energy sources, including wind and hydroelectric power, necessitates sophisticated protective relay systems to manage variable generation and maintain grid stability in an increasingly complex energy landscape.

Aging Infrastructure Replacement :

Widespread replacement of legacy protection systems across Canadian provinces presents substantial market opportunities as utilities upgrade aging infrastructure to meet modern safety standards and operational requirements.

Market Definition

A protective relay is a power system component that senses abnormalities or faults in the power system and initiates the control circuit operation. Major power system components such as transmission lines, feeders, busbars, transformers, motors, generators, and capacitor banks are capital-intensive assets that need to be protected in case of faults. Protective relays serve this purpose by continuously monitoring system health and by initiating switchgear operation to disconnect the faulty sections of the power network.

The market for protective relays is defined as the sum of revenues global companies generate from selling their protective relays. These devices are used by various end-users such as utilities, industries, railway & metro, and others.
